Package com.google.genai.types
Class GroundingChunkCustomMetadata.Builder
java.lang.Object
com.google.genai.types.GroundingChunkCustomMetadata.Builder
- Enclosing class:
- GroundingChunkCustomMetadata
Builder for GroundingChunkCustomMetadata.
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ionabstract GroundingChunkCustomMetadatabuild()clearKey()Clears the value of key field.Clears the value of numericValue field.Clears the value of stringListValue field.Clears the value of stringValue field.abstract GroundingChunkCustomMetadata.BuilderSetter for key.abstract GroundingChunkCustomMetadata.BuildernumericValue(Float numericValue) Setter for numericValue.abstract GroundingChunkCustomMetadata.BuilderstringListValue(GroundingChunkStringList stringListValue) Setter for stringListValue.stringListValue(GroundingChunkStringList.Builder stringListValueBuilder) Setter for stringListValue builder.abstract GroundingChunkCustomMetadata.BuilderstringValue(String stringValue) Setter for stringValue.
-
Constructor Details
-
Builder
public Builder()
-
-
Method Details
-
key
Setter for key.key: The key of the metadata.
-
clearKey
Clears the value of key field. -
numericValue
Setter for numericValue.numericValue: Optional. The numeric value of the metadata. The expected range for this value depends on the specific `key` used.
-
clearNumericValue
Clears the value of numericValue field. -
stringListValue
public abstract GroundingChunkCustomMetadata.Builder stringListValue(GroundingChunkStringList stringListValue) Setter for stringListValue.stringListValue: Optional. A list of string values for the metadata.
-
stringListValue
@CanIgnoreReturnValue public GroundingChunkCustomMetadata.Builder stringListValue(GroundingChunkStringList.Builder stringListValueBuilder) Setter for stringListValue builder.stringListValue: Optional. A list of string values for the metadata.
-
clearStringListValue
Clears the value of stringListValue field. -
stringValue
Setter for stringValue.stringValue: Optional. The string value of the metadata.
-
clearStringValue
Clears the value of stringValue field. -
build
-